Multiwire-type two-dimensional neutron detector with high pressure for J-PARC MLF BL17 neutron reflectometer

藤 健太郎  ; 中村 龍也  ; 坂佐井 馨  ; 山岸 秀志*

To, Kentaro; Nakamura, Tatsuya; Sakasai, Kaoru; Yamagishi, Hideshi*

Neutron reflectometry experiments using a gaseous two-dimensional neutron detector system with multiwire elements have been performed at the MLF BL17 Sharaku at the J-PARC Center. We have developed a two-dimensional neutron detector for BL17 utilizing a multiwire-type detector element known for its reliability. This system has been operating reliably for over 10 years without major maintenance. Initially, the detector used a low-pressure fill gas (0.27 MPa) due to a helium-3 shortage. To improve sensitivity, a new high-pressure detector (0.7 MPa) was developed, featuring a robust pressure vessel and updated signal processing circuits. Pulsed neutron irradiation tests showed that the new detector's sensitivity at the TOF peak (12.4 ms, neutron energy 11 meV) was approximately twice that of the original detector. Results from a Cf source and pulsed neutrons will be presented.
